How much do pastry bakery cook j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 10, 2026, the average hourly pay for pastry bakery cook in the United States is $18.72,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$16.83 and $20.43 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Position Summary
The Pastry Cook is responsible for the preparation, production, and presentation of a variety of pastries, desserts, baked goods, and specialty items in accordance with World Equestrian Center standards. This position supports daily pastry operations by following recipes, maintaining quality standards, ensuring food safety compliance, and contributing to an exceptional guest experience.
Successful candidates possess a passion for baking, strong attention to detail, creativity, and the ability to work efficiently in a fast-paced culinary environment.
Essential Duties & Responsibilities
  • Prepare a variety of pastries, cakes, cookies, breads, desserts, and specialty baked goods according to established recipes and production schedules.
  • Measure, mix, shape, bake, decorate, and finish bakery and pastry items.
  • Ensure consistency in product quality, appearance, taste, and presentation.
  • Follow all food safety, sanitation, and health department regulations.
  • Maintain proper food labeling, dating, storage, and rotation procedures.
  • Assist with buffet, banquet, restaurant, retail, catering, and special event dessert production.
  • Decorate cakes and desserts utilizing approved techniques and presentation standards.
  • Monitor inventory levels and communicate product needs to supervisors.
  • Receive, inspect, and properly store pastry and baking ingredients.
  • Maintain a clean, organized, and sanitary workstation and production area.
  • Operate bakery and pastry equipment safely and efficiently.
  • Assist with seasonal offerings, special events, holiday programs, and custom orders.
  • Support opening, closing, cleaning, and side work responsibilities.
  • Work collaboratively with chefs, culinary leadership, and fellow team members.
  • Perform other duties as assigned.
